As always, if you are having problems-
it is always best to go straight to the manufacturer-
Ambient Pressure Diving.
You may pay a bit more but they will ALWAYS deliver within a week, and their customer service is genuinely pretty good. Save yourself the hassle. (Either that or order a metric ton from Molecular Products, I'm sure they will deliver)
